Google Suggests Quantum Attacks on Cryptocurrency Encryption May Require Fewer Resources
Google researchers report that improved quantum algorithms could break widely used cryptocurrency encryption with fewer resources.

According to the white paper, solving the elliptic curve discrete logarithm problem may require roughly 1,200 logical qubits and under 500,000 physical qubits, with attack times measured in minutes on sufficiently advanced systems.
